Businesses always require capital for growth and expansion. Sometimes such capital is raised through means like bank loans that usually involve collateral and some other such requirements. Other people raise capital through other means as well such as selling shares of their company on a publicly traded exchange such as the New York Stock Exchange or the London Stock Exchange. Some shares are sold as OTC or over the counter shares, basically meaning they are not traded over any known exchanges. Most business owners appreciate the benefits of a public stock offering on any exchange worldwide in order to raise funds but not all business owners can partake of this means of raising capital.

The requirements necessary to offer shares for sale on the world’s major exchanges have seen companies resorting to other means to raise capital such as private stock offerings. By offering stock as OTC stock in an offshore jurisdiction, business owners can avoid the financial and bureaucratic red tape and raise money offshore by selling shares of their company to a multitude of worldwide private investors. The cost of raising money through such means is always much less than the cost it would take to raise money in your own country on a public exchange. Some exchanges require that a company must have been in existence for up to 5 years and have a share capital running into hundreds of millions of dollars before they can make such offers.
